Wohlenberg steps up to head STOXX supervisory board

Holger Wohlenberg, managing director of Deutsche Borse, has been elected chairman of the supervisory board of STOXX.

Wohlenberg succeeds Werner Burki, chairman since April 2004, who will continue to serve as a member of the supervisory board. The change is effective immediately and a result of the regular annual election of the chairman of the supervisory board.

Wohlenberg has served as managing director of Deutsche Borse since July 2004, where he is responsible for the exchange's Market Data & Analytics business. Previously, Wohlenberg headed the Technology Investment Banking group at Deutsche Bank.
